In addition, investors and startups also need to interact freely with each other at startup pitching events, which form an integral part of the startup ecosystem. These networking events bring together both investors and startup owners face-to-face for fruitful collaboration and success.

At these events, startups get an opportunity to showcase their products and services to a wide range of audiences, primarily angel investors and venture capitalists, while on the other hand, investors get a chance to explore various groundbreaking startup ideas and firms to invest in.

But it’s easier said than done. Much work goes on behind the scenes to make a startup pitching event successful. Organizing a pitch event can be a big challenge for event organizers and startup accelerators if they don’t have effective software smartly designed for demo day.

Here are some common pain points that organizers face while organizing demo day pitching events:

Survey Responses

One of the most critical aspects of demo day pitching events is obtaining feedback and ratings from attendees. At a live event, investors often find a few pitches interesting; however, as time passes, it becomes challenging for them to recall which startup presentations they liked, unless they revisit the event recording.

As a result, investors may miss opportunities to rate pitches or provide valuable feedback, often due to their busy schedules and the complexities involved in the process. This can be a significant setback for both startups and event organizers. Understanding how investors and event attendees perceive the event is essential. Startups are naturally curious about how their pitches were received by the audience.

Unfortunately, implementing real-time feedback collection can be a challenging task without a dedicated platform.

Built-in Timer

Another major hassle that event organizers face is the time limit. In a traditional startup pitching event, most startups get an allocated time to deliver their startup pitch. Many times, startup founders go beyond the stipulated time while delivering their pitch. It not only fails the purpose of the pitch but also makes the event go haywire.

To ensure that the event goes smoothly without any issue, a built-in timer is a must to take care of the event pitches and schedule. It helps organizers ensure that the presenter gets the allocated time to complete their pitch and also alerts the presenters and organizers as the stipulated time comes to an end with a warning buzzing sound.
